How to Determine Which Type of Bike to BuyWhen you go to buy a bike, you will find that you have a choice between mountain bikes, road bikes or hybrids. But which bike makes the most sense for you? Step 1Decide what you want to do with the bike. Where do you want to ride? How often? Is comfort a top priority, or is performance more important?Step 2Buy a mountain bike if you want to ride off road. Mountain bikes also make great city bikes. If you don't plan to ride off road, simply switch to smoother tires.Step 3Buy a road bike if you want to go fast, and if you only ride on the pavement. Road bikes are light and efficient, but people who don't ride very often generally find them uncomfortable.Step 4Buy a hybrid if you want the upright, comfortable riding position of a mountain bike, and the efficiency of a road bike. Hybrids are great for city riding, commuting, and light trail riding.Step 5Consider a one-speed cruiser for a quality low-cost, low-maintenance bike. Cruisers are great for running errands and getting around a college campus. But watch out for long hills! |
